1. From the same article:
"Zahorchak resigned Thursday with little explanation and was retained by the district as director of strategic initiatives, a position that requires no office hours and allows him to keep his $195,000 salary this year, along with a $55,000 bonus."

Yet, 112 teachers were laid off and some principals lost their jobs. Zahorchak was a disaster.
